How do the world’s most successful investors achieve an out-performance of the market? What helps them determine what stocks to buy?

For decades famous – and not so famous – investors have been using a variety of strategies to screen the market and narrow down potential shares.  Analysis shows that it’s more lucrative to focus on a set of shares with defined characteristics than to invest across a wide variety of markets. Smarter Stock Picking walks you through the key screening techniques that will enable you to make discriminating  and intelligent share choices.

 

Over the long term, stocks and shares have proven themselves to be one of the best investments available. Despite some risks, they beat both bonds and cash.

 

But what’s the most effective way to ensure that you’re using the best strategies to buy the best shares?

 

Using proven research based studies, Smarter Stock Picking walks you through each screening technique and shows you how to deploy key strategies that will help you successfully pick the right stocks so that you can get the right returns.  Drawing on a range of ideas and theories from classic value investing through to popular momentum based strategies it explains the thinking and the actual measures used, and will help you develop your own strategies.

About the Author:

David Stevenson is a columnist for the FT Weekend edition, and writes the Adventurous Investor section which is about everything from investing in Mongolia through to using ETFs in your portfolio. He’s also a columnist for the Investors Chronicle (based around his SIPP) and before that was a columnist for Citywire. David writes extensively about ETFs for the IC and the Financial Times and is currently developing a series of Master Portfolios for the IC.
